Overview

EX Dragon, released November 24, 2003, is the first set to heavily feature Dragon-type Pokemon in the EX era. With 100 cards, it introduced Rayquaza, Latios, and Latias to the TCG as Pokemon-ex, establishing Dragon as a dominant force in competitive play.

Top of the chart

Most valuable cards

Rayquaza ex (#97) is the top chase card and one of the most iconic EX-era cards overall. Latios ex (#96) and Latias ex (#93) are also highly collected. Golem holo and Salamence holo are solid non-ex pickups.

01 Is Rayquaza ex from EX Dragon valuable?

Yes. Rayquaza ex (#97) is one of the most valuable EX-era cards. Near mint copies sell for $100–$300, with PSA 10 grades reaching $2,000+. It remains a fan-favorite chase card.

02 What legendary Pokemon are in EX Dragon?

EX Dragon features Rayquaza ex, Latios ex, and Latias ex as the headline legendary Pokemon. All three are Dragon-type Pokemon-ex cards.

03 How many cards are in EX Dragon?

EX Dragon contains 100 cards including regular holos, non-holo rares, uncommons, commons, and Pokemon-ex cards numbered at the end of the set.

04 Was Dragon-type new in EX Dragon?

Dragon-type was not entirely new but received its first major spotlight in EX Dragon. The set established Dragon as a premium type with powerful ex cards and holographic rares.
